The Writing Guides offer detailed descriptions, guidelines and tips, and online practice materials to help you write effective texts, both in real life and exam situations.

The two tasks in the Euroexam Writing test at Levels B2 and C1 require you to demonstrate your written communication skills in a specified situation. With your texts, you are expected to achieve a particular purpose in the given genre in an appropriate style.

The 5 Genres

While in real life, we may have to write texts in our mother tongue or in a foreign language in a huge variety of genres, Euroexam candidates have the luxury of having to focus on and prepare for the writing of five specific genres only:

  • Transactional Email;
  • Essay;
  • Online Article;
  • Review;
  • Online Comment.

Structure of the Guides

Each of the easy-to-follow guides is structured identically (and also includes language recommendations):

  • introduction to the key features of the genre, with possible topics,
  • functions and key features of the opening paragraph,
  • functions, communicative and language features of body paragraphs,
  • functions and features of the closing paragraph,
  • stylistic features of the genre,
  • useful online materials for further preparation.
